The Journey of “Wagon Wheel”: From Bob Dylan to Old Crow Medicine Show

The Journey of Wagon Wheel: From Bob Dylan to Old Crow Medicine Show

The story of “Wagon Wheel” begins long before Old Crow Medicine Show’s rendition. The song’s origins are deeply rooted in the work of Bob Dylan.

Dylan, a pivotal figure in American folk music, reportedly started writing “Wagon Wheel” back in the 1970s. That version remained largely unfinished, a collection of verses and a lyrical framework. However, the initial conception clearly resonated with his creative spirit.

The song then took a significant leap when it was picked up by Old Crow Medicine Show. Their adaptation and completion of the song launched it into the mainstream.
